Inclusions and Accommodations

Travelers can expect a well-organized experience with a variety of inclusions and comfortable accommodations throughout the trip.
They’ll enjoy transportation in an air-conditioned deluxe coach and stay in 4-star hotels, ensuring a restful night’s sleep. Each morning starts with a complimentary breakfast, covering five meals in total.
Highlights include a Douro River cruise and wine tasting in Porto, all guided by a bilingual tour director fluent in English and Spanish.
Plus, travel insurance and gratuities are included, while local city taxes in Lisbon and Porto are conveniently paid directly to hotels, making the journey hassle-free.

Transportation and Travel Information

While exploring Portugal, you will enjoy comfortable and efficient transportation throughout the tour.
Travel takes place in an air-conditioned deluxe coach, ensuring a pleasant journey between destinations. Each traveler can bring one suitcase and one carry-on, with a maximum weight of 30 kg (66 lb), making it easy to manage luggage.
The tour accommodates up to 40 travelers, fostering a more intimate experience. However, it’s important to note that the tour isn’t wheelchair accessible.
For families, infants under three can join for free if they don’t require a seat, adding flexibility for parents traveling with young children.

Reviews and Feedback

How do travelers feel about their experiences on the Portugal tour from Madrid? Reviews are mixed, with an overall rating of 3.9 out of 5.
Many travelers praise the tour’s organization and knowledgeable guides, appreciating the seamless transitions between destinations. However, some express concerns about hotel quality and occasional chaotic excursions.
Plus, a few suggest that focusing on language efficiency could enhance the experience. Despite these minor inconveniences, most participants find the tour reasonably priced and enjoyable, making it a popular choice for first-time visitors eager to explore Portugal’s stunning landscapes and rich history.
